## Prefetcher: smarter tile warm-up for Lanternmap

This PR changes the map-tile prefetcher to prioritize tiles along the user's predicted pan direction instead of a fixed ring around the viewport. During the Harborwick incident we saw the old ring strategy saturate the tile cache and evict hot tiles, which caused the blank-map reports. The new predictor caps concurrent fetches and backs off when cache hit rate drops below threshold. If you're on call and need to retune under load, these are the knobs that matter.

tuning table, yajog-yahof:
BUDGETS = {
    "lamvan": 303,
    "wenox": 460,
    "fenvan": 525,
}

### Step 6 — Apply rate-limit config to Gatewick

Before promoting the rate-limiting rules to the internal Gatewick API gateway, verify the staging burst thresholds match the values approved in the change record, then sign the config bundle. Unsigned bundles are rejected at the control plane. Use exactly the deploy key shown below for signing.

deploy key for kajof-fajop: bky6_gDHw9Q

Tindle follows strict semver, but with one house rule: visual-only changes (spacing, color tokens) count as minor, never patch, because downstream snapshot tests will break. Major bumps require a migration note and a two-sprint deprecation window. Contractors should pin exact versions in consuming apps rather than using ranges; the Brackenfold build pipeline rejects floating dependencies anyway. For the full policy, including how release candidates are cut and who approves major bumps, see the versioning guide here.

wiki page, yaweg-tawep: https://vault.nelvrotech.local/board/secrets/build/build/dash/run/job/3557e844d3f4d283dcee17aa

## 7.1.0 — Changed test defaults for Coppervault payments

Our integration tests against the Coppervault payments sandbox have been flaky due to aggressive default timeouts and a shared mock ledger. Starting with this release, each test run provisions an isolated ledger, the default request timeout doubles to 20 seconds, and retries are disabled so failures surface immediately. External plugin authors running the conformance suite should update their harnesses accordingly. To align your suite with the new defaults, apply the values shown below.

deployment values, tafog-fajef:
[jorox]
team = norael
access_code = ac_b6e7bf
owner = oliael.silwyn
host = jorox.qorveltech.internal
port = 8443
peer = oliius.paliqlabs.local
salt = 0b6288ee
pin = 8391